Family Feud Turns Fatal: Missouri Man Charged with Brother’s Murder Amid Longstanding Rivalry
SUGAR CREEK, MO — A local man has been charged with the murder of his brother, marking a tragic end to what family members describe as a longstanding sibling rivalry exacerbated by envy and mental health issues. The 43-year-old Sugar Creek resident Jacob Ackerman faces second-degree murder charges after police allege that he shot his brother in the back of the head during a dispute.
